i dont know why but when i try this my nail polish drys in the water when im making the bulls eye =( how do i make it so i have time to finish my bulls eye and have time to create the design i want?? im not taking long it can be in the water for like 30 secs and its all dried up.
HotMomma1137 4 months ago
@HotMomma1137 every polish dries at a different speed & those that dry fast just aren't very good for marbling - if you can't work any quicker then you have to find colors that dry slower =) Also make sure there's not a fan or anything creating a draft on the water as that can make the polish dry faster

How do you prevent bubbles when doing water marbling?
AbbiesNails 4 months ago
@AbbiesNails My 3 main tips to prevent bubbles would be: make sure there are none in the polish before you dip you nail (you can pop those), dip in & out slowly, and make sure to get rid of any water drops on your nail - if they won't drip or shake off, you can use the corner of a paper towel to absorb them. HTH =)

mine doesn't spread right and sometimes it just drops to the bottom like a ball
musicfan248 4 months ago
@musicfan248 some polish sinks because it’s too dense, other times it is from dripping it from too high up, try to stay close to the surface of the water - also are you using room temperature filtered water? keep in mind that not all polish works - the brand doesn't really matter but every color is different in the water & it just takes a lot of trial & error to find the ones that work well =)
